IS32LT3175N/P Single-Channel Linear LED Drivers

ISSI IS32LT3175N/P Single-Channel Linear LED Drivers come with fade in/out and PWM dimming. The regulators serve as a stand-alone LED driver-configurable from 20mA to 150mA with external resistors, no microcontroller is necessary. A logic level “courtesy light” signal from the PWM pin can be interfaced to precisely drive the LED channel. The IS32LT3175P obtains a positive polarity PWM signal. In addition, the IS32LT3175N obtains a negative polarity PWM signal. The regulator integrates a 63-step fade-in and fades out the algorithm (Gamma correction). This causes the output LED current to increasingly rise up to the full source value after the EN pin is pulsed.

LP8866-Q1 High-Efficiency LED Driver

Texas Instruments LP8866-Q1 High-Efficiency LED Driver comes with a boost controller. The six high-precision current sinks support phase shifting, automatically adjusted based on the number of channels used. LED brightness can be controlled globally through the I2C interface or PWM input. The boost controller has adaptive output voltage control based on the headroom voltages of the LED current sinks. This feature minimizes power consumption by adjusting the boost voltage to the lowest sufficient level in all conditions. A wide-range adjustable frequency allows the LP8866-Q1 to avoid disturbance from the AM radio band. The Texas Instruments LP8866-Q1 supports built-in hybrid PWM dimming and analog current dimming, which reduces EMI, extends the LED lifetime, and increases the total optical efficiency.
